A. V. Spikes, 94 passed away peacefully on Saturday October 22, 2011 at Pleasant Hills Community Living Center in Jackson.
He was born August 1, 1917 in Fulton Louisiana. He was a World War II veteran who loved to tell his war stories and was also past commander of the VFW Post 112 in Jackson. He retired from Knox Glass after thirty two years and then worked for the Rankin County Sherriff Department. He loved to play his guitar and always had a beautiful vegetable garden every year until he had to give it up at the age of 90. He loved to make people laugh with his jokes which he never forgot. He was a long time member of Trinity Baptist Church in Pearl.
He was preceded in death by his parents Hiram B. and Pearl Spikes, his four sisters and four brothers and his son A. V. Spikes, Jr. who was killed in Vietnam in 1966.
He is survived by his wife Bobbie Douglas Spikes of 65 years, his daughter Sandra (Heerssen) and husband Kerry of Texas, daughter Judy (Jones) and husband Duane of Carthage, son Harold Spikes of Pearl, daughter Sharon (Trosper) and husband Kenny of Byram and his son Brad Spikes of Pearl; thirteen grandchildren, fifteen great grandchildren and one great-great grandson.
